Summary
Overview
Work History
Skills
PROFILE
Timeline
Generic

Asel Sulaiman

Summary

Proficient in all stages of the Software Development Life Cycle (SDLC), Software Testing Life Cycle (STLC), and Bug Life Cycle (BLC), adept within both Waterfall and Agile frameworks. Demonstrated a strong command of Java, SQL, and Rest Assured, alongside a deep understanding of the software development and testing life cycles. Highly experienced with Jira for project management, defect tracking, and GitHub for version control. Adept in UI testing, and proficient in implementing Data Driven and Behavior Driven Development (DDD, BDD) methodologies using Java. Skilled in Selenium WebDriver for web application automation, managing Maven projects, and creating Cucumber-based frameworks with Gherkin. Well-versed in TestNG and JUnit for test organization, Jenkins for continuous integration, and SQL for database manipulation and data validation. Solid grasp of Java OOP principles in test automation.

Overview

6
6
years of professional experience

Work History

SDET

American Home Shield
04.2021 - Current
  • Actively engaged in Agile Scrum processes, contributing valuable insights that led to a 30% improvement in project delivery timelines
  • Conducted a range of tests, including Smoke Testing, Regression Testing, and Functional Testing
  • Masterfully designed and developed highly efficient, adaptable automated test scripts using Java as an Object-oriented Programming language, coupled with the powerful capabilities of Selenium WebDriver
  • Executed the Page Object Model (POM) as a design pattern
  • Implemented Behavior-Driven Development (BDD) with Cucumber, improving team collaboration and aligning testing efforts with business goals
  • Automated test reports using Cucumber plugin HTML reports and Json reports attached with failed scenario screenshots
  • Primarily responsible for executing daily Smoke Tests through the continuous integration
  • Utilized JIRA for effective bug tracking and project management, streamlining the defect resolution process and fostering better collaboration among team members
  • Conducted extensive API testing for RESTful services, validating functionality, performance, and security aspects
  • Utilized Postman and custom automation scripts to simulate various API usage scenarios, ensuring robustness and scalability
  • Effectively and efficiently collaborated with scrum team members.

QA AUTOMATION ENGINEER

Caterpillar
07.2018 - 04.2021
  • Collaborated closely with the Project Manager, Business Analyst, and other team members to develop a bug free application
  • Proficient in API Web Services testing using Rest Assured with Java as a programming language
  • · Actively participate in Agile Scrum ceremonies, including sprint planning, daily stand-ups, sprint re
  • Led the development and implementation of a state-of-the-art automated testing framework using Selenium and Java, achieving a 40% reduction in regression testing time
  • Executed various testing methods including Functional, Smoke, Regression testing methods
  • Used JIRA as the management tool for the maintenance of the test cases and to track the defects
  • Experience in the design and development of automated testing framework, including User Interface and API testing
  • Designed and implemented automated testing frameworks using JavaScript with Selenium WebDriver, increasing test coverage and efficiency by over 50%.
  • Executed the development of a Behavior Driven Development (BDD) framework based on Cucumber and complemented it with JUnit for assertions and annotations
  • Used Jenkins as Continuous integration tool for running Smoke Test daily.

Skills

    JAVA JavaScript Selenium WebDriver Maven Cucumber BDD TDD Gherkin JUnit TestNG Page Object Model JDBC IntelliJ IDE Eclipse IDE CSS XPATH Database MySQL SQL Oracle Jenkins CI/CD Bamboo Smoke Testing Regression Testing Functional Testing HTML Apache POI Restful API Postman Mobile Testing JIRA Slack Agile /Scrum GitHub RestAssured TestRail

PROFILE

Highly skilled Software Development Engineer in Test (SDET) with 5 years of extensive experience in designing, implementing, and maintaining test automation frameworks using the latest technologies and best practices.

Timeline

SDET

American Home Shield
04.2021 - Current

QA AUTOMATION ENGINEER

Caterpillar
07.2018 - 04.2021
Asel Sulaiman